2016年3月30日 星期三

[Ruby]Ubuntu 底下安裝 Ruby on Rails

Ubuntu 上透過 RVM 安裝 Ruby on Rails

一、 使用 RVM 安裝 Ruby

為確保我們待會下載的程式都是最新版的,先更新系統。
sudo apt-get update
sudo apt-get upgrade

更新完成以後,我們就能開始安裝 RVM ( Ruby Version Manager ),這個程式可以很方便的讓我們在不同的 Ruby 版本間作切換, 以下我們只會安裝最新的版本,如果想要安裝其他的版本,可以參考這個文章
我們會需要用到 curl 這個工具來幫助我們安裝 RVM ,所以還沒安裝過curl 的朋友請先安裝curl 
sudo apt-get install curl

安裝 RVM,請輸入:
\curl -sSL https://get.rvm.io | bash

(因參考原本的語法有問題,所以有做更改)

當安裝完成以後,載入 RVM
或許你需要將目前所處於的 shell 關閉,並重開一個新的 shell
source ~/.rvm/scripts/rvm

RVM 還有一些需要的依賴程式需要安裝,輸入下面這個指令可以自動安裝 RVM 所需的相關程式
rvm requirements

二、安裝 Ruby

已經安裝好 RVM 的話,那麼安裝 Ruby 就變得很簡單了。
rvm install ruby

安裝完成後,要使用哪一個版本的 Ruby 當作預設值。
rvm use ruby --default

三、安裝 RubyGems

這個步驟是為了確保我們有正確安裝 Ruby on Rails 所需的所有 Gems ,如此一來 Rails 才能正確執行。我們可以透過 RVM 來繼續安裝 RubyGems
rvm rubygems current

第四、安裝 Rails

當上面步驟都完成以後,現在我們可以安裝 Rails 了。
gem install rails